When inspecting the crown/tread area of a tire, if groove cracks are found they should be carefully assessed. Tires with groove cracks that are consistently 1/16 inch or greater in depth should be removed from service, as this may indicate a problem covered by a warranty. This is particularly critical if the groove cracks have exposed steel or fabric, which can signify severe wear or tire damage necessitating immediate attention.
